Early Detection and Screening

At Michoes Medical Centre, we believe that early detection is key to effective treatment. Our team offers various screening tests, such as low-dose computed tomography (LDCT), sputum cytology, and bronchoscopy, to help identify lung cancer at its earliest stage.

Treatment Options

Our lung cancer treatment options include:

  • Surgery: We offer minimally invasive surgery, such as video-assisted thoracic surgery (VATS), to remove tumors and improve lung function.
  • Chemotherapy: Our chemotherapy program uses a range of medications to target cancer cells and reduce symptoms.
  • Targeted Therapy: We use targeted therapies that specifically target cancer cells, reducing harm to healthy tissue.
  • Radiation: Our radiation therapy team offers intensity-modulated radiation therapy (IMRT) to precisely target tumors and minimize side effects.
  • Clinical Trials: We participate in clinical trials to test new treatments and provide access to innovative therapies.

Supportive Care

We understand that living with lung cancer can be challenging. Our team provides comprehensive supportive care, including:

  • Oncology nutrition: Our registered dietitians offer personalized nutrition counseling to ensure you receive the necessary nutrients for optimal health.
  • Symptom management: We provide guidance on managing symptoms such as pain, shortness of breath, and fatigue.
  • Palliative care: Our palliative care team offers emotional support, symptom relief, and holistic approaches to improve quality of life.
